California Laws You Should Know
Unruh Civil Rights Act & ADA Compliance
All California businesses are required to make content accessible to people with disabilities, which includes everything from their website to their internal educational resources.
California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A)
Any recorded audio or transcribed content that contains personally identifiable information is subject to CCPA regulations, which give consumers more control over how their personal data is used.
California Two-Party Consent Law (Penal Code 632)
California requires all parties to consent to being recorded. This applies to recording phone calls, meetings, and in-person conversations.
AB 1825/SB 1343 Training Records
California businesses with more than five employees are required to document sexual harassment training and store records for at least three years.
Court-Filed Transcripts
Transcripts submitted in California courts must meet specific formatting and accuracy standards, such as Rule 5.532.
